>Thanks. Just when your message popped in I was actually looking for 
>splitters. Found a Griffin MicConnect interface but that is not what I 
>want. From what I have learned so far, the mic technology assumed by 
>the iPhone is passive Dynamic mic. No Bias is supplied by the iPhone 
>(probably would have been my guess anyway).

>>  Hi Phil,
>>
>>  I can't speak to the quality of the mic on those earbuds, but there 
>>are a number of splitter cables out there that will split the mic and 
>>speaker signals form the TRRS jack on you earbud cable to the mic and 
>>speaker connections on your KX3.
>>
>>  I use one I ordered from Amazon to do just that when using my ASUS 
>>T100TA tablet for digital modes with my KX3. Sorry I don't currently 
>>have a link, but there are a number of them out there with various 
>>prices and quality.

>>>  When I operate portable with my KX3 I am often favoring my Apple 
>>>iPhone earbuds over other headsets. I have no measure of whether 
>>>these are better or worse then others (I also own CM500 but it is big 
>>>and bulky) -- but they work fine for me so far. And, in portable ops, 
>>>I have been 100 percent CW so voice quality has not been an issue.
>>>
>>>  But...
>>>
>>>  If I wanted to switch to SSB for some reason I am thinking: "Is 
>>>there a way to use the mic that is integrated with these iPhone 
>>>earbuds?".
>>>
>>>  In a perfect world where there is no resistance nor taxes, this 
>>>would work without any special plugs or jacks just like it works on 
>>>my iPhone but I don't expect that. Has anyone done this? Has anyone 
>>>adapted this mic for use on the KX3? I don't even know the mic 
>>>technology (electret, dynamic, etc.).
